Description

SAIC is seeking an Sr. Systems Engineer Integrator in Chantilly, VA to support SAIC’s large SETA program, supporting the NRO’s Ground Enterprise Directorate (GED), Advanced Ground Office. With a background in support to Space Programs providing Enterprise Systems Engineering and Integration, you will work with stakeholders to provide end-to-end closure of requirements for space programs (Indications and Warnings (I&W)/ Integration and Closure (I&C)), consult with Government leads, develop CONOPS, participate in verification, test and systems integration efforts, and conduct gap identification, analysis, and assessments. In this senior role, you will serve as a cross-functional integrator, drive integration and migration planning, and serve as the ultimate advocate for client mission success. This position requires on-site support at customer locations and is ideal for a seasoned professional who thrives in complex, mission-critical environments.

Key Responsibilities to include
  • Lead integration planning, design, and execution across enterprise cloud and tactical edge environments, ensuring seamless interoperability between systems, data services, and third-party applications within an open-architecture framework.
  • Translate integration requirements into technically sound interface control documents, API specifications, and data exchange agreements that support bi-directional, cross-platform data sharing across classified and unclassified network domains.
  • Serve as the primary technical liaison between Government stakeholders, vendors, and development teams to ensure integration requirements are accurately captured, communicated, traceable, and verifiable throughout the program lifecycle.
  • Evaluate and validate platform integration capabilities including data onboarding and normalization, credential authority, object databases, API performance, and interoperability across multiple security domains.
  • Participate in product demonstrations, design reviews, and agile development cycles, providing rapid technical assessment of integration solution compliance against documented requirements and operational needs.
  • Collaborate with vendors, partners, requirements analysts, and Government stakeholders to identify and resolve integration risks, dependencies, and technical gaps throughout the program lifecycle.
  • Lead the integrating and implementation of designs and architectures across and into multiple systems and platforms.
  • Conduct in-depth analysis of intelligence information requirements and operational environments.
  • Develop and maintain planning baselines to support program execution and technical decision-making.
  • Lead the creation and management of integration schedules, migration plans, and roadmaps, ensuring alignment with program objectives and client needs.
  • Interact frequently with internal and external senior management and customer representatives regarding projects, operational decisions, scheduling requirements, and contractual matters.
  • Work closely and effectively with the Architecture Lead to identify, test, and implement technical solutions.
  • Directly manage and mentor subordinate engineers and experienced specialist staff who operate with significant latitude and independence.
  • Collaborate with senior management to review operational outcomes and ensure organizational objectives are being met.
  • Establish and enforce operating policies and procedures that govern departmental and cross-functional work units.
  • Interpret and apply government-wide policies and procedures to ensure consistent, compliant operations.
